OneAPI媒体内容工厂:通义万相配图+千问文案+Claude视频脚本,AIGC全流程自动化
本文介绍了如何在星图GPU平台自动化部署支持标准OpenAI API格式的OneAPI镜像,实现开箱即用的多模型统一访问。该方案可一站式调用通义万相生成产品配图、通义千问创作文案及Claude生成视频脚本,适用于电商、社交媒体等场景的AIGC内容自动化生产。
OneAPI媒体内容工厂:通义万相配图+千问文案+Claude视频脚本,AIGC全流程自动化
安全提示:使用 root 用户初次登录系统后,务必修改默认密码
123456!
1. 什么是OneAPI媒体内容工厂?
想象一下这样的场景:你需要为一款新产品制作宣传材料——既要生成吸引人的文案,又要设计精美的配图,还要编写专业的视频脚本。传统方式需要找文案、设计师、视频策划三个不同的人协作,耗时耗力还难协调。
OneAPI媒体内容工厂解决了这个痛点。它是一个统一的AI模型管理平台,让你能够通过标准的OpenAI API格式访问所有主流大模型,实现"AIGC全流程自动化"。简单来说,就是用一套系统调用通义万相生成图片、通义千问创作文案、Claude编写视频脚本,真正实现"一条龙"内容生产。
最棒的是,这个系统开箱即用,单文件部署,不需要复杂的配置就能快速上手。无论你是个人创作者还是企业团队,都能立即体验到多模型协同工作的强大能力。
2. 核心功能详解
2.1 全模型支持能力
OneAPI最大的优势在于其惊人的模型兼容性。它不仅仅支持OpenAI系列模型,而是几乎涵盖了所有主流的大模型服务:
国际主流模型:
- OpenAI ChatGPT全系列(包括Azure OpenAI)
- Anthropic Claude系列(支持AWS Claude)
- Google PaLM2/Gemini系列
- Mistral系列模型
- Cohere、xAI、DeepSeek等
国内优秀模型:
- 字节跳动豆包大模型(火山引擎)
- 百度文心一言系列
- 阿里通义千问系列
- 讯飞星火认知大模型
- 智谱ChatGLM系列
- 360智脑、腾讯混元等
其他特色模型:
- Moonshot AI、百川大模型、MINIMAX
- Groq高速推理、Ollama本地模型
- 零一万物、阶跃星辰、Coze
- DeepL翻译、together.ai、novita.ai
这意味着你不需要为每个模型单独学习不同的API调用方式,一套标准接口就能玩转所有主流AI模型。
2.2 媒体内容工厂工作流
让我们具体看看如何实现"AIGC全流程自动化":
第一步:通义万相生成配图
# 生成产品宣传图
import openai
client = openai.OpenAI(api_key="your_oneapi_key", base_url="http://your-oneapi-domain/v1")
response = client.images.generate(
model="tongyi-wanxiang", # 通过OneAPI调用通义万相
prompt="现代简约风格的产品宣传图,主打科技感,蓝色调",
size="1024x1024",
quality="standard",
n=1,
)
image_url = response.data[0].url
print(f"生成图片地址: {image_url}")
第二步:通义千问创作文案
# 生成产品宣传文案
response = client.chat.completions.create(
model="qwen-turbo", # 通过OneAPI调用通义千问
messages=[
{"role": "system", "content": "你是一名专业的营销文案写手"},
{"role": "user", "content": "为我们的智能手表写一段吸引人的产品描述,突出健康监测和长续航特点"}
],
max_tokens=500
)
copywriting = response.choices[0].message.content
print(f"生成文案: {copywriting}")
第三步:Claude编写视频脚本
# 生成视频脚本
response = client.chat.completions.create(
model="claude-3-sonnet", # 通过OneAPI调用Claude
messages=[
{"role": "system", "content": "你是专业的视频脚本策划师"},
{"role": "user", "content": "基于前面的产品图片和文案,创作一个30秒的短视频脚本,包含画面描述和配音文案"}
],
max_tokens=800
)
video_script = response.choices[0].message.content
print(f"视频脚本: {video_script}")
这样,只需要几分钟就能完成传统需要数小时的内容创作流程。
2.3 高级管理功能
OneAPI不仅仅是一个模型代理,更是一个完整的管理系统:
智能负载均衡:支持多个渠道的负载均衡,自动分配请求到不同的模型提供商,保证服务稳定性。
精细化权限控制:
- 令牌管理:设置令牌的过期时间、使用额度、IP访问限制
- 模型访问控制:精确控制每个令牌可以访问哪些模型
- 用户分组管理:不同用户组设置不同的费率和使用权限
商业级功能:
- 兑换码管理系统:批量生成和导出充值码
- 渠道分组和费率设置:为不同渠道设置不同的计费倍率
- 用户邀请奖励机制:通过邀请新用户获得额度奖励
- 额度明细查询:详细记录所有额度使用情况
自定义与扩展:
- 完全自定义界面:修改系统名称、LOGO、页脚
- 自定义首页和关于页面:支持HTML和Markdown
- 管理API支持:通过API令牌扩展系统功能
- 多主题切换:支持不同的界面主题风格
3. 快速部署指南
3.1 一键部署方案
OneAPI提供多种部署方式,最简单的就是Docker一键部署:
# 拉取最新镜像
docker pull justsong/one-api
# 运行容器
docker run --name one-api -d --restart always \
-p 3000:3000 \
-e TZ=Asia/Shanghai \
-v /home/ubuntu/data/one-api:/data \
justsong/one-api
部署完成后,访问 http://你的服务器IP:3000 即可进入管理系统。首次登录使用账号 root 和密码 123456,记得立即修改默认密码。
3.2 模型配置示例
部署完成后,需要添加模型渠道。以配置通义千问为例:
- 登录OneAPI管理后台
- 进入"渠道"页面,点击"添加渠道"
- 选择"通义千问"作为类型
- 输入从阿里云获取的API密钥
- 设置权重和优先级
- 测试连接并保存
同样地,你可以继续添加通义万相(图片生成)、Claude(视频脚本)等其他模型渠道。
3.3 客户端配置
配置完成后,客户端只需要使用统一的OneAPI端点:
# 所有模型都通过同一个端点访问
client = openai.OpenAI(
api_key="你的OneAPI令牌",
base_url="http://你的oneapi域名/v1"
)
# 无论调用什么模型,都是同样的格式
response = client.chat.completions.create(
model="qwen-turbo", # 这里改成claude-3或其他模型名称即可
messages=[...]
)
这种统一化的接口让代码维护变得极其简单,切换模型只需要修改一个参数。
4. 实际应用案例
4.1 电商内容自动化
某电商团队使用OneAPI实现了商品详情页的自动化制作:
- 主图生成:通义万相根据商品特征生成吸引人的主图
- 详情文案:通义千问基于商品参数编写详细的描述文案
- 视频创意:Claude生成15秒短视频脚本用于商品推广
- 批量处理:通过OneAPI的批量接口,一次性处理数百个商品
效率提升:从原来每个商品需要2-3小时的人工制作时间,减少到10分钟的自动化处理。
4.2 社交媒体内容创作
自媒体团队利用OneAPI搭建了每日内容生产线:
- 早间新闻:通义千问总结昨日热点,生成新闻简报
- 中午图文:通义万相生成配图,千问创作解说文案
- 晚间视频:Claude编写视频脚本,生成完整分镜
4.3 企业培训材料制作
企业培训部门使用OneAPI快速生成培训材料:
- 概念图解:通义万相生成技术概念示意图
- 课程文案:通义千问编写详细的课程内容
- 案例脚本:Claude创作实际应用案例和情景剧本
5. 最佳实践建议
5.1 模型选择策略
不同的内容类型适合不同的模型:
| 内容类型 | 推荐模型 | 特点 |
|---|---|---|
| 技术文案 | 通义千问、Claude | 逻辑清晰,技术准确 |
| 创意文案 | GPT-4、Claude | 创意丰富,表达生动 |
| 图片生成 | 通义万相、DALL-E | 中文理解好,符合本土审美 |
| 视频脚本 | Claude、GPT-4 | 场景感强,叙事流畅 |
5.2 成本优化方案
通过OneAPI的智能路由功能,可以实现成本优化:
# 设置模型优先级,优先使用性价比高的模型
models_priority = [
"qwen-turbo", # 成本最低,适合简单任务
"claude-3-haiku", # 中等成本,平衡质量与价格
"gpt-4-turbo" # 高质量,用于重要内容
]
for model in models_priority:
try:
response = client.chat.completions.create(
model=model,
messages=messages
)
break # 成功则跳出循环
except Exception as e:
continue # 失败则尝试下一个模型
5.3 质量保障措施
- 人工审核环节:重要内容设置人工审核节点
- A/B测试:对同一任务使用不同模型生成,选择最佳结果
- 反馈循环:建立质量评分系统,持续优化提示词
- 版本控制:对提示词和生成结果进行版本管理
6. 总结
OneAPI媒体内容工厂代表了AIGC应用的未来方向——不是单一模型的强大,而是多模型协同的智能。通过统一的API接口管理所有主流大模型,让创作者可以专注于内容创意本身,而不是技术实现的细节。
核心价值总结:
- 统一接入:一套接口访问所有主流模型,降低技术复杂度
- 流程自动化:实现从文字、图片到视频的全流程内容生产
- 成本优化:智能路由和负载均衡最大化性价比
- 灵活扩展:丰富的管理功能满足各种业务场景
下一步行动建议:
- 从简单的Docker部署开始体验
- 先配置1-2个常用模型渠道(如通义千问+万相)
- 尝试自动化一个具体的业务场景
- 逐步扩展模型类型和使用范围
无论是个人创作者还是企业团队,OneAPI都能为你打开AIGC内容生产的新世界大门,让创意不再受技术限制,让内容生产真正实现智能化、自动化。
获取更多AI镜像
想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。
更多推荐


所有评论(0)